59 MPs named in the Parliament unrest report

The Committee appointed to investigate the unrest reported within Parliament on the 14th, 15th and 16th of November has recommended that action should be taken against 59 Parliamentarians in connection to the incident.

Referring to the report compiled by the Committee the BBC Sinhala Service reported charges are levelled against 54 Parliamentarians of the United People’s Freedom Alliance, four United National Party Parliamentarians and one JVP Parliamentarian.

MP Prasanna Ranaweera has been charged with 12 offences followed by Parliamentarians Padma Udayashantha and Johnston Fernando.

The BBC said UPFA MPs Dilum Amunugama, Ananda Aluthgamage, Indika Anurudda, Mahindananda Aluthgamage, Arundika Fernando, Niroshan Premaratne, Nishantha Muthuhettigama and Ranjith Soysa are among those named in the report.

Meanwhile charges were also levelled against UNP Parliamentarians Palitha Thevarapperuma and Ranjan Ramanayake in the report.

The report compiled by the Committee headed by Deputy Speaker of House Ananda Kumarasiri is due to be tabled before the Attorney General for further action.
